CIAA files case against one for allegedly bribing its employee



KATHMANDU: The Commission for the Investigation of Abuse of Authority (CIAA) has filed a case against Dhruva Prasad Sapkota, the Chief Administrative Officer of Kispang Rural Municipality, Nuwakot, for allegedly bribing a CIAA employee.

Sapkota is accused of offering a bribe of Rs 100,000 to an investigation officer during an inquiry into the municipality’s machinery purchase by the CIAA’s Kanchanpur office.

He was arrested by the Commission while trying to influence the investigation under the pretense of submitting related documents to avoid further action on the case.

The CIAA has demanded imprisonment, a fine of Rs 100,000, and asset confiscation in the case filed before the Special Court.
